Cal/West Educators Placement is devoted to matching qualified educators with appropriate openings as administrators and teachers in West Coast independent and private schools. As a way of expressing our appreciation and support to the schools and candidates with whom we work, we are continuing a program of financial assistance to help teachers, administrators, and other school personnel attend Professional Development workshops, conferences, classes, and other events which they might otherwise be unable to attend due to financial constraints. Cal/West Professional Development Grants are limited to a minimum of $200 and a maximum of $1,000 each. Awards may be for the full amount requested or a partial sum, and may cover some or all of a program’s costs. The applicants school is expected to cover some of the program costs.

Requirements

  1. Applicants must be employees of independent or private schools in California or neighboring states.
    1. An application must be completed. The application can be downloaded and printed from our web site at grantapp.CalWestEducators.com.
  2. The application must be co-signed by the Head of School or the Division Head of the applicant's school.
  3. Grants can be paid only to a school, or an educational program or entity, and may only be used for the purpose stated in the application. Financial recipients will be responsible for tax consequences, if any.

Grant applicants may submit a letter of support from the Head of School, Department Head, or other appropriate individual. This is not a requirement.

Professional Development Grants will be made on the basis of demonstrated need, qualifications and goals of the applicant, proposed use of the funds, and available funding. Awards may be for the full amount requested or a partial sum to supplement other available funds.

Final grant decisions will be made by the Cal/West Educators Placement senior staff, with advice and input from a volunteer committee of qualified educators. Cal/West will attempt to award as many grants as possible given available funding. The grants program may be renewed, suspended, or re-opened from time to time. Unfortunately, it is unlikely that we will be able to fund all requests that we receive.

Deadlines
It is anticipated that Professional Development Grants will be awarded approximately 4 times per year on a "rolling" basis. Applicants are urged to submit their applications as early as possible, with a lead time of at least 6 weeks before a final decision is needed. However, there will be times when it may take longer to reach a decision on applications. We will make our best effort to provide applicants with decisions as soon as possible.
